A firearm was fired at a oil tanker as it was crossing the Strait of Hormuz, causing a minor fire on board. The UK Maritime Trade Operations confirmed that there were no casualties or serious environmental impact, noting that the incident occurred 12 nautical miles north of Khassab city in Oman. This event comes amid escalating tensions in the region, where the Strait has witnessed numerous military and political incidents, including the detention of vessels and Iran's repeated assertions of closing the strait without coordinating with other countries.
